Here's an On-Foot Look at the Nike Dunk Low “Halloween”
A “Shattered Backboard” colorway injected with a spooky twist.






In preparation for the spooky holiday, Nike is releasing a new special edition Dunk Low “Halloween” which adds to this year’s chilling lineup along with the SB Dunk Low “Mummy.”
The design follows a white, burnt orange, and black color scheme resembling the likes of the Air Jordan 1 “Electro Orange” and the Air Jordan 1 “Shattered Backboard” series. White leather fills up the toe box, quarters and collars with black overlays stitched over the shoe featuring a glow-in-the-dark print of various eyes. A burnt orange hue takes over the midfoot Swoosh, nylon tongue and collar lining. The white midsoles with a black contrast stitching sit over a bed of glow-in-the-dark outsoles to cap off the look.
The Nike Dunk Low “Halloween” is set to release for $120 USD this October at select retailers and Nike’s official website.
